Output 51db6d9a80abdb0f05e62abba19e8c53b8916bfbf54ba02a5e67a3a13b903497:3

value
366987360
script pubkey
OP_0 OP_PUSHBYTES_20 facd2593c648e7617c77d9838cdad31c793c4f27
address
bc1qltxjty7xfrnkzlrhmxpcekknr3uncne8sht7rn
transaction
51db6d9a80abdb0f05e62abba19e8c53b8916bfbf54ba02a5e67a3a13b903497
confirmations
192508
spent
true